Pizza Grilled Cheese Sandwiches: Crazy Melt!

Enjoy these simple and delicious Pizza Grilled Cheese Sandwiches, a quick and easy fusion of two classic comfort foods. Perfect for a weeknight dinner or a fun lunch, these sandwiches deliver cheesy, saucy goodness in minutes.

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 4 tablespoons grated parmesan cheese
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 8 thick slices sturdy bread, such as sourdough or Italian
  • 1 1/2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up pizza sauce or marinara sauce
  • 24 thin slices pepperoni

Instructions

  1. In a small mixing bowl, blend softened unsalted butter, grated parmesan cheese, Italian seasoning, garlic powder, and salt until the mixture is uniformly combined.
  2. Spread a thin layer of pizza sauce or marinara sauce over 4 bread slices.
  3. Top each with an even layer of shredded mozzarella cheese and 6 slices of pepperoni.
  4. Cover with remaining bread slices to form sandwiches.
  5. Generously coat the outer sides of each sandwich with the prepared garlic butter mixture.
  6. Preheat a skillet over medium heat.
  7. Grill sandwiches for 3 to 4 minutes per side, pressing gently, until the bread is golden and crisp and the cheese has fully melted.
  8. Slice sandwiches in half and serve immediately, accompanied by extra warm marinara sauce if desired.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, add more Italian seasoning to the garlic butter mixture.
  • You can substitute the pepperoni with other toppings like veggies or different types of cheese.
